Research interests

My research interests center around the design, development and operation of CCD and CMOS camera systems, with a focus on their application in the space environment and the image degradation that arises due to radiation damage. I am particularly interested in testing and developing cryogenic irradiation techniques, as well as investigating potential new technologies such as P-Channel CCDs. Currently, I am leading cryogenic irradiation campaigns on detectors for the Euclid mission, testing novel P-channel CCDs,聽and analyzing in-orbit radiation degradation data from the Gaia mission.

ESA p-channel contract change notification
RoleStart dateEnd dateFunding source
Co-investigator05 Sep 201601 Sep 2017ESA (European Space Agency)

The CEI have been working under contract to ESA (CLS-404-14) on an investigation in the performance characterisation and radiation testing of p-channel CCDs. This work is now nearing completion and ESA have indicated that they would like to fund an additional study under a contract change notification (CCN). This additional study will focus on the evolution of defects within a back illuminated p-channel and n-channel CCD204 after the devices have been irradiated&/people/bd2976/44; side-by-side&/people/bd2976/44; and for a period of time after&/people/bd2976/44; whilst cold annealing takes place.
